ITP granted more funding from NSFC in 2012


In the recently released news, ITP scientific staff received funding from NSFC for 30 applied programs, totaling RMB 25.16 million.

Among the 30 programs, 18 are general programs, and 9 are Young Scientists Fund ranging from alpine biology, hydrology, geomorphology, geotectonic and geophysics evolving around the Tibetan Plateau. In addition, two Key Programs have been granted, with Profs YI Chaolu and WANG Shiping as respective PI. Dr. WANG Xiaoping studying Persistent Organic Pollutants (POSPs) in the Tibetan Plateau also won the Excellent Young Scientists Fund.
